/* ----------------------------------------------------------------------	連合隊メニュー---------------------------------------------------------------------- */ul {	list-style: none;}#nav {	margin: 0;	padding: 0;	DISPLAY: block;	Z-INDEX: 5;	MARGIN: 0;	LIST-STYLE-TYPE: none;	TEXT-ALIGN: right}#nav a {	padding: 0;	display: block;	background: #FFF;	TEXT-DECORATION: none;	FLOAT: left;	MARGIN: 0;}#nav li {	white-space : nowrap;	DISPLAY: block;	FLOAT: left;	LIST-STYLE-TYPE: none;	POSITION: relative;}#nav LI LI {	FLOAT: none}#nav LI LI A {	FLOAT: none;	POSITION: relative}#nav LI UL {	MARGIN-TOP: 2.2em;	MARGIN-LEFT: -1000em;	WIDTH: 10em;	POSITION: absolute}#nav A:hover {	COLOR: #FFF;	BACKGROUND-COLOR: #D6FF98;}#subMenusContainer {	DISPLAY: block;	Z-INDEX: 1000000000;	OVERFLOW: visible;	HEIGHT: 0;	POSITION: absolute;	WIDTH: 100%;	TOP: 0;	LEFT: 0;}#subMenusContainer a {	width: 96px;	DISPLAY: block;	BACKGROUND-COLOR: #FFC;	TEXT-DECORATION: none;	TEXT-ALIGN: left;	color: #666;	font-size: 12px;	PADDING: 5px;	BORDER-RIGHT: #c3d46a 1px solid;	BORDER-LEFT: #c3d46a 1px solid;	BORDER-BOTTOM: #c3d46a 1px solid;}#subMenusContainer A:hover {	COLOR: #FF8400;	BACKGROUND-COLOR: #FFF;}.smOW {	DISPLAY: none;	padding: 0;	MARGIN: -3px 0 0;	OVERFLOW: hidden;	POSITION: absolute;}#subMenusContainer UL {	PADDING: 0;	MARGIN: 0;	LINE-HEIGHT: 1em;	LIST-STYLE-TYPE: none;}#subMenusContainer li {	LIST-STYLE-TYPE: none;}.mHeader {	width:93px;}.mBtn {	width:76px;}